class Migration(migrations.Migration):

    dependencies = [
        ('advert', '0006_auto_20210324_1429'),
    ]

    operations = [
        migrations.AddField(
            model_name='advert',
            name='statustype',
            field=models.CharField(choices=[('0', 'همه نوع'), ('1', 'ویلایی'),
                                            ('2', 'آپارتمانی'), ('3', 'زمین'),
                                            ('4', 'سایر موارد')],
                                   default='0',
                                   max_length=1,
                                   verbose_name='نوع ملک'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='house_type',
            field=models.CharField(choices=[('0', 'همه نوع'), ('1', 'ویلایی'),
                                            ('2', 'آپارتمانی'), ('3', 'زمین'),
                                            ('4', 'سایر موارد')],
                                   default='0',
                                   max_length=1,
                                   verbose_name='نوع خانه'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='poster',
            field=models.ImageField(default='image_default\\default.jpg',
                                    upload_to=advert.models.change_file_name,
                                    verbose_name='پستر'),
        ),
    ]
class Migration(migrations.Migration):

    dependencies = [
        ('advert', '0005_auto_20210214_2037'),
    ]

    operations = [
        migrations.RemoveField(
            model_name='advert',
            name='is_privet',
        ),
        migrations.AddField(
            model_name='advert',
            name='address',
            field=models.TextField(blank=True, null=True, verbose_name='ادرس'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='category',
            field=models.CharField(choices=[('0', 'همه نوع قرار داد'), ('2', 'فروش'), ('3', 'رهن'), ('4', 'اجاره')], default='0', max_length=1, verbose_name='وضعیت اگهی'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='house_type',
            field=models.CharField(choices=[('0', 'همه نوع'), ('1', 'ویلایی'), ('2', 'آپارتمانی'), ('3', 'زمین'), ('4', 'سایر موارد')], default='0', max_length=1, verbose_name='وضعیت اگهی'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='poster',
            field=models.ImageField(default='image_default\\default.jpg', upload_to=advert.models.change_file_name, verbose_name='پستر'),
        ),
    ]
Exemple #3
0
class Migration(migrations.Migration):

    dependencies = [
        ('advert', '0008_auto_20210324_1457'),
    ]

    operations = [
        migrations.AlterField(
            model_name='advert',
            name='baths',
            field=models.CharField(choices=[('0', 'هر تعداد'), ('1', '1-2'), ('2', '3-4'), ('3', '5-6')], default='1', max_length=1, verbose_name='حمام'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='beds',
            field=models.CharField(choices=[('0', 'هر تعداد'), ('1', '1-2'), ('2', '3-4'), ('3', '5-6')], default='1', max_length=1, verbose_name='اتاق خواب'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='poster',
            field=models.ImageField(default='image_default\\default.jpg', upload_to=advert.models.change_file_name, verbose_name='پستر'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='wc',
            field=models.CharField(choices=[('0', 'هر تعداد'), ('1', '1-2'), ('2', '3-4'), ('3', '5-6')], default='1', max_length=1, verbose_name='سرویس بهداشتی'),
        ),
    ]
class Migration(migrations.Migration):

    dependencies = [
        ('advert', '0014_auto_20210325_2045'),
    ]

    operations = [
        migrations.AlterField(
            model_name='advert',
            name='poster',
            field=models.ImageField(default='image_default\\default.jpg',
                                    upload_to=advert.models.change_file_name,
                                    verbose_name='پستر'),
        ),
    ]
Exemple #5
0
class Migration(migrations.Migration):

    dependencies = [
        ('advert', '0001_initial'),
    ]

    operations = [
        migrations.AlterField(
            model_name='advert',
            name='poster',
            field=models.ImageField(default='image_default\\default.jpg', upload_to=advert.models.change_file_name, verbose_name='پستر'),
        ),
        migrations.CreateModel(
            name='AdvertView',
            fields=[
                ('id', models.AutoField(auto_created=True, primary_key=True, serialize=False, verbose_name='ID')),
                ('user_ip', models.CharField(blank=True, max_length=150, null=True, verbose_name='ip کاربر')),
                ('view', models.IntegerField(blank=True, default=0, null=True, verbose_name='تعداد بازدید')),
                ('advert', models.ForeignKey(on_delete=django.db.models.deletion.CASCADE, related_name='advertview', to='advert.Advert', verbose_name='آگهی')),
            ],
        ),
    ]
class Migration(migrations.Migration):

    dependencies = [
        ('advert', '0013_auto_20210325_1321'),
    ]

    operations = [
        migrations.AlterField(
            model_name='advert',
            name='category',
            field=models.CharField(choices=[('1', 'فروش'), ('2', 'رهن'), ('3', 'اجاره')], default='0', max_length=1, verbose_name='وضعیت اگهی'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='poster',
            field=models.ImageField(default='image_default\\default.jpg', upload_to=advert.models.change_file_name, verbose_name='پستر'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='price',
            field=models.IntegerField(blank=True, null=True, verbose_name='قیمت'),
        ),
    ]
Exemple #7
0
class Migration(migrations.Migration):

    dependencies = [
        ('advert', '0003_auto_20210213_1218'),
    ]

    operations = [
        migrations.CreateModel(
            name='Option',
            fields=[
                ('id',
                 models.AutoField(auto_created=True,
                                  primary_key=True,
                                  serialize=False,
                                  verbose_name='ID')),
                ('title',
                 models.CharField(max_length=150,
                                  unique=True,
                                  verbose_name='عنوان')),
            ],
        ),
        migrations.AlterField(
            model_name='advert',
            name='poster',
            field=models.ImageField(default='image_default\\default.jpg',
                                    upload_to=advert.models.change_file_name,
                                    verbose_name='پستر'),
        ),
        migrations.AddField(
            model_name='advert',
            name='options',
            field=models.ManyToManyField(blank=True,
                                         null=True,
                                         related_name='advert_option',
                                         to='advert.Option'),
        ),
    ]
class Migration(migrations.Migration):

    dependencies = [
        ('advert', '0007_auto_20210324_1456'),
    ]

    operations = [
        migrations.AlterField(
            model_name='advert',
            name='poster',
            field=models.ImageField(default='image_default\\default.jpg',
                                    upload_to=advert.models.change_file_name,
                                    verbose_name='پستر'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='statustype',
            field=models.CharField(choices=[('0', 'همه دسته بندی ها'),
                                            ('1', 'تجاری'), ('2', 'مسکونی')],
                                   default='0',
                                   max_length=1,
                                   verbose_name='نوع ملک'),
        ),
    ]
Exemple #9
0
class Migration(migrations.Migration):

    initial = True

    dependencies = [
        migrations.swappable_dependency(settings.AUTH_USER_MODEL),
    ]

    operations = [
        migrations.CreateModel(
            name='Advert',
            fields=[
                ('id',
                 models.AutoField(auto_created=True,
                                  primary_key=True,
                                  serialize=False,
                                  verbose_name='ID')),
                ('Uid',
                 models.UUIDField(default=uuid.uuid4,
                                  editable=False,
                                  unique=True)),
                ('title', models.CharField(max_length=50,
                                           verbose_name='عنوان')),
                ('slug',
                 autoslug.fields.AutoSlugField(editable=False,
                                               populate_from='title')),
                ('poster',
                 models.ImageField(default='image_default\\default.jpg',
                                   upload_to=advert.models.change_file_name,
                                   verbose_name='پستر')),
                ('detail',
                 models.CharField(max_length=80, verbose_name='جزئیات')),
                ('price',
                 models.CharField(blank=True,
                                  max_length=50,
                                  null=True,
                                  verbose_name='قیمت')),
                ('area', models.CharField(max_length=150,
                                          verbose_name='متراژ')),
                ('stat', models.CharField(max_length=150,
                                          verbose_name='منطقه')),
                ('beds', models.IntegerField(verbose_name='اتاق خواب')),
                ('baths', models.IntegerField(verbose_name='حمام')),
                ('wc', models.IntegerField(verbose_name='سرویس بهداشتی')),
                ('garages',
                 models.BooleanField(default=True, verbose_name='پارکینگ')),
                ('house_type',
                 models.CharField(choices=[('V', 'ویلایی'), ('A', 'آپارتمانی'),
                                           ('O', 'سایر موارد')],
                                  default='O',
                                  max_length=1,
                                  verbose_name='وضعیت اگهی')),
                ('category',
                 models.CharField(choices=[('B', 'خرید'), ('S', 'فروش'),
                                           ('R', 'رهن'), ('A', 'اجاره')],
                                  default='S',
                                  max_length=1,
                                  verbose_name='وضعیت اگهی')),
                ('description',
                 models.TextField(max_length=500, verbose_name='توضیحات')),
                ('is_public',
                 models.BooleanField(default=False, verbose_name='عمومی')),
                ('is_privet',
                 models.BooleanField(default=False, verbose_name='خصوصی')),
                ('year_created', models.IntegerField(verbose_name='سال ساخت')),
                ('created_at',
                 models.DateTimeField(auto_now_add=True,
                                      verbose_name='زمان ساخت')),
                ('updated_at',
                 models.DateTimeField(auto_now=True,
                                      verbose_name='زمان اپدیت')),
                ('is_active',
                 models.BooleanField(default=True,
                                     verbose_name='فعال/غیر فعال')),
                ('url',
                 models.URLField(blank=True,
                                 null=True,
                                 verbose_name='ادرس ویدیو')),
                ('user',
                 models.ForeignKey(on_delete=django.db.models.deletion.CASCADE,
                                   related_name='user_advert',
                                   to=settings.AUTH_USER_MODEL,
                                   verbose_name='کاربر')),
            ],
        ),
        migrations.CreateModel(
            name='GalleryImage',
            fields=[
                ('id',
                 models.AutoField(auto_created=True,
                                  primary_key=True,
                                  serialize=False,
                                  verbose_name='ID')),
                ('image',
                 models.ImageField(default='image_default\\default.jpg',
                                   upload_to=advert.models.change_file_name,
                                   verbose_name='عکس')),
                ('advert',
                 models.ForeignKey(on_delete=django.db.models.deletion.CASCADE,
                                   related_name='gallery',
                                   to='advert.Advert')),
            ],
        ),
    ]
Exemple #10
0
class Migration(migrations.Migration):

    dependencies = [
        ('advert', '0011_auto_20210324_1619'),
    ]

    operations = [
        migrations.AlterField(
            model_name='advert',
            name='baths',
            field=models.CharField(choices=[('1', '1-2'), ('2', '3-4'),
                                            ('3', '5-6')],
                                   default='1',
                                   max_length=1,
                                   verbose_name='حمام'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='beds',
            field=models.CharField(choices=[('1', '1-2'), ('2', '3-4'),
                                            ('3', '5-6')],
                                   default='1',
                                   max_length=1,
                                   verbose_name='اتاق خواب'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='category',
            field=models.CharField(choices=[('2', 'فروش'), ('3', 'رهن'),
                                            ('4', 'اجاره')],
                                   default='0',
                                   max_length=1,
                                   verbose_name='وضعیت اگهی'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='house_type',
            field=models.CharField(choices=[('1', 'ویلایی'),
                                            ('2', 'آپارتمانی'), ('3', 'زمین'),
                                            ('4', 'سایر موارد')],
                                   default='0',
                                   max_length=1,
                                   verbose_name='نوع خانه'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='poster',
            field=models.ImageField(default='image_default\\default.jpg',
                                    upload_to=advert.models.change_file_name,
                                    verbose_name='پستر'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='statustype',
            field=models.CharField(choices=[('1', 'تجاری'), ('2', 'مسکونی')],
                                   default='0',
                                   max_length=1,
                                   verbose_name='نوع ملک'),
        ),
        migrations.AlterField(
            model_name='advert',
            name='wc',
            field=models.CharField(choices=[('1', '1-2'), ('2', '3-4'),
                                            ('3', '5-6')],
                                   default='1',
                                   max_length=1,
                                   verbose_name='سرویس بهداشتی'),
        ),
    ]